how many zeros does this polynomial function, y=(x-8)(x+3)^2

Respuesta :

jimrgrant1 jimrgrant1
  • 01-02-2019

Answer:

3

Step-by-step explanation:

The factor (x - 8) has 1 zero at x = 8

The factor (x + 3)² has a zero at x = - 3 of multiplicity 2

In total there are 3 zeros
